According to the checklist provided, to stop the engines we should normally use the RUN/CRANK/STOP switches in the STOP position for 3 seconds and put the power controls on full reverse.
However, the RUN/CRANK/STOP switches do not stop the engines (these switches have only two positions). To stop the engines, we have to close the MAIN fuel valves or put the Condition Levers in the EMER STOP position.
=> Is this the expected functioning ?

Posted

No.

A third position of switches  to STOP engines can be found if you point the mouse cursor below them. An arrow pointing down will appear and you can stop the engine correctly.

Posted (edited)

Okay, I've figured out how it works. The RUN/CRANK/STOP switches must be first in the down position for this click zone to be active.
